Blue Estate Announced for Xbox One and PS4: Rail Shooter Based on Eisner Nominated Comic

The psychotic Tony Luciano makes his way to next gen consoles.

Blue Estate

HESAW and Focus Home Interactive have announced that a video game adaptation of Viktor Kalvachev’s Eisner Award nominated Blue Estate will be out for the PS4 and Xbox One. Players will assume the roles of the homicidal Tony Luciano and ex-Navy SEAL Clarence as they go to war with the Sik gang to rescue Ton’s very own “Helen of Troy”.

The game will be a rail shooter awash in technicolour pastels and take advantage of the motion controller functionality of the PS4 and Xbox One as you fight against a deranged set of enemies which include Chihuahuas. You’ll have a primary and secondary weapon to face off against enemies, including bosses, but you’ll need to make the best use of cover while shooting as well.

While the Xbox One version will Kinect, the PS4 version will use gyroscopic motion functionality. Check out the first screenshots from the game below and let us know what you think in the comments.
